Same-Sex Couple In Odisha Seeks Protection From Family
Same-Sex Couple In Odisha Seeks Protection From Family

Even though Section 377 has been decriminalized in the country, the stigma against a same-sex marriage is still prevalent in the society. This couple from Danagadi area of Jajpur is a victim of the same stigma and has sought protection. Subhalakshmi Pati and Lakshmipriya Mishra, aged 22 and 21, respectively had decided to get married after being together for two years.

Mystery Tree On Bhubaneswar Outskirts Is Held Sacred By Many
Mystery Tree On Bhubaneswar Outskirts Is Held Sacred By Many

This huge tree and the anthill beside it have created a lot of curiosity in the minds of people. This place is considered sacred with locals thronging it to offer prayers. People who come to visit this spot believe that this tree has the power to grant one’s wishes. This is ‘Ajaneshwar Pitha’ located in Simulipatna village in Bhubaneswar

Nandi Mountain’s Transformation Into A Temple & Tourist Hotspot
Nandi Mountain’s Transformation Into A Temple & Tourist Hotspot

This is the Nandi Mountain in Baghuapalli village under Bhapur block of Nayagarh district. A colossal temple gracefully stands on this mountain. After 12 years of hard work of the villagers, this sacred Baba Akhandala Mani Temple has come to life. Specialised craftsmen from Puri lent their artistic touches to the construction of this temple.

Historic! India Retain Border-Gavaskar Trophy With Gabba Win | OTV News
Historic! India Retain Border-Gavaskar Trophy With Gabba Win | OTV News

The Indian cricket team created history at the Gabba, showcasing supreme tenacity to retain the coveted Border-Gavaskar trophy. In a victory that created many records, India defeated Australia in the fourth and final Test at Brisbane today. Successfully chasing a 328-run target to seal the four-match series 2-1, this was a historic win for India on foreign soil.
